This can exacerbate any demographic biases exhibited by the model. We focus on gender bias resulting from systematic errors in grammatical gender translation, which can lead to human referents being misrepresented or misgendered.\n  Most approaches to this problem adjust the training data or the model. By contrast, we experiment with simply adjusting the inference procedure.
